Cirque du Soleil returns to Calgary with its latest big top production Amaluna which premieres on April 11, 2013 for a limited engagement under the blue-and-yellow Big Top at Stampede Park (Lot #6). Directed by Diane Paulus, a renowned theatre director from New York, Amaluna had its world-premiere in Montreal in April 2012 and is now touring North America.

2013 will mark the 25th anniversary of the first visit of Cirque du Soleil in Calgary. Following the Calgary engagement, Amaluna will raise its trademark Blue and Yellow Big Top in Edmonton. This will be the first time that a Cirque du Soleil big top production visits Edmonton.
